Assessing Your Home's Solar Prospective
Prior to diving into solar panel installment, you should examine your home's solar capacity. Start by checking your roof's alignment and slope; south-facing roofs normally record the most sunshine.
Try to find any kind of blockages, like trees or high structures, that can cast shadows on your panels. These can substantially reduce power production. Consider your neighborhood environment also; warm areas generate much better outcomes than continually over cast regions.
Next, assess your energy demands and use patterns to establish the number of panels you'll call for. You may additionally want to use online solar calculators or talk to a specialist to get a more clear photo.

Panel Effectiveness Rankings
As you check out the globe of solar panels, understanding panel efficiency scores is essential for making an educated choice. These rankings indicate just how properly a panel converts sunlight into usable electrical power. The higher the performance, the more power you'll produce from a smaller space. The majority of domestic panels vary from 15% to 22% performance.
When choosing your panels, consider your power needs and readily available roofing system area. If you have actually limited area, opting for higher-efficiency panels could be valuable. However, if you have adequate roof location, lower-efficiency panels could be enough.
Installment Kind Alternatives
Selecting the ideal installment kind for solar panels can significantly influence your system's efficiency and efficiency. You'll generally run into two main options: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are usually the best option for property owners, as they utilize existing room and can be less expensive to set up. However, if your roof isn't ideal-- maybe because of shading or architectural issues-- ground-mounted systems may be the far better option.
They permit optimal positioning, maximizing sunshine direct exposure. Furthermore, solar panel installation at home can adjust their angle to boost performance.
Before deciding, consider variables like offered area, budget plan, and local laws. By reviewing these choices carefully, you'll guarantee your solar panel installation fulfills your energy requires successfully.
Visual Considerations
While capability is vital, aesthetic appeals should not be forgotten when picking sol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only job effectively but also enhance your home's design.
Consider the shade and size of the solar panels; black panels commonly blend seamlessly with dark roofing systems, while blue panels could stand apart more. Check out choices like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that change standard roofing materials, providing a smooth appearance.
You might also discover solar tiles, which resemble common roof and can enhance visual charm. Don't forget to evaluate the layout and positioning of the panels to take full advantage of both effectiveness and visual consistency.
Ultimately, striking the best balance between performance and aesthetic appeals will make your solar financial investment a lot more gratifying.
